Job Summary

Extension Agent for Family and Consumer Sciences – Harlan County

Location:

Harlan, KY

The Extension Agent for Family and Consumer Sciences will develop, implement, and evaluate a plan of work based on locally identified needs which will lead to improved quality of living for families & individuals. Will plan and implement educational programs which focus on:
1) making healthy choices;
2) nurturing families;
3) embracing life as you age;
4) securing financial stability;
5) promoting healthy homes and communities;
6) accessing nutritious food; and
7) empowering community leaders. Will develop expertise and serve as a resource in family and consumer sciences programming areas including: food and nutrition; family resource management; human development and family relations; health, safety and wellness; leadership development; clothing and textiles; housing and the environment; home based and micro business. Will implement educational programs which strengthen families and individuals. Will develop and implement leadership programs such as Kentucky Extension Homemakers resulting in the development of personal and organizational leadership skills.

All agents in a county will support the dissemination of useful and practical information on subjects relating to Agriculture, Family Consumer Sciences, 4-H and Community and Rural Development as outlined in the KRS statutes 164.605 to 164.675.
